Mikhail Nikolaevich Pokrovsky (1868-1932) is a historian and academician of the Academy of Sciences of the USSR. He graduated from the Faculty of History and Philology of Moscow University and received serious scientific training from historical professors V.O.Klyuchevsky and P.G.Vinogradov. Since 1907, Pokrovskys articles on the history of the national economy, domestic and foreign policy, and the social movement of Russia have been published in the collective 9-volume History of Russia in the 19th Century and the Encyclopedic Dictionary of the Granat Brothers.
